modul praktikum teknik komputasi d3mi praktikum 1 2
Post on 02-Mar-2016
71 Views
Preview:
DESCRIPTION
TRANSCRIPT
-
Page 1
Modul Praktikum Teknik Komputasi
Oleh :
Yuni Yamasari, S.Kom, M.Kom
D3 MI , Teknik Elektro, FT, Unesa
2013
-
Page 2
Praktikum 1. Pendahuluan Matlab Matlab adalah singkatan dari Matrix Laboratory, software yang dibuat dengan
menggunakan bahasa ini dibuat oleh The Mathworks.inc. Matlab memiliki kemampuan
antara lain:
Kemudahan manipulasi struktur matriks.
Jumlah routine-routine powerful yang berlimpah yang terus berkembang.
Kekuatan fasilitas grafik tiga dimensi yang sangat memadai.
Sistem scripting yang memberikan keleluasaan bagi pengguna untuk
mengembangkan dan memodifikasi software untuk kebutuhan sendiri.
Kemampuan interface dengan fasilitas Mfile yang digunakan untuk menyimpan
program.
Dilengkapi dengan toolbox, simulink, stateflow dan sebagainya, serta mulai
melimpahnya source code di internet yang dibuat dalam matlab( contoh toolbox
misalnya : signal processing, control system, neural networks dan sebagainya).
Dengan kemampuan yang telah dimiliki tersebut maka MATLAB dapat digunakan untuk :
membantu melakukan perhitungan yang sederhana dan rumit dengan fungsi built-in
di MATLAB ( dianalogikan sebagai kalkulator). Sehingga matlab dapat digunakan
untuk membantu perhitungan yang berkaitan dengan materi-materi matematika
antara lain aljabar, differensial, integral , metode numerik dan lain sebagainya.
membangun aplikasi.
Lingkungan Matlab Lingkungan kerja utama Matlab terdiri dari main menu dan toolbar yang terdiri dari menu
dan menubar yang ada di Matlab; current directory , informasi direktori kerja kita saat ini;
command history, history tentang perintah-perintah yang pernah kita tuliskan dalam
command window dan command window merupakan window dimana kita menuliskan
perintah yang berkaitan dengan perhitungan di Matlab. Lingkungan kerja utama Matlab
terlihat pada gambar 1 berikut ini:
-
Page 3
Aturan-Aturan Dasar Matlab Matlab mempunyai beberapa aturan aturan dasar sintak antara lain:
1. Semua data dan operasinya di MATLAB diperlakukan sebagai array.
2. Perintah ditulis perbaris
3. Jika setelah selesai mengetikkan perintah, dan tidak diakhir dengan tanda ; (titik
koma), maka hasilnya langsung ditampilkan (di-assign ke variabel ans)
jika ada ; (titik koma) maka tidak ditampilkan.
4. Nilai yang digunakan adalah nilai terakhir pada variabel.
5. Variabel dalam Matlab bersifat Case Sensitive
6. Variabel maksimal 31 Karakter
7. Variabel tidak boleh diawali dengan angka. Jika nama variabel lebih dari satu kata,
gunakan tanda _ (underscore). Variabel TIDAK BOLEH ada spasinya.
8. Tipe Data yang ada dimatlab terdiri dari Numeric dan String
9. Gunakan tanda atau untuk melihat perintah yang telah diketikkan sebelumnya
dan sesudahnya.
10. Tekan Enter untuk Eksekusi
Main menu & Toolbar
Command Window
Current Directory
Command History
-
Page 4
Penggunaan Help Matlab Matlab menyediakan banyak fungsi yang tidak mungkin kita hafal semua. Kita dapat
mengetahui fungsi-fungsi apa saja yang tersedia dimatlab dengan bantuan fasilitas help.
Fasilitas help yang berkaitan dengan matematika dapat kita akses dengan langkah-langkah
sebagai berikut:
1. Klik menubar help seperti tapak pada gambar disamping:
2. Klik submenuUsing the Desktop atau Using the Command Window, kemudian
klik fx Functions sehingga muncul tampilan sebagai berikut:
-
Page 5
Aritmatika Dasar
Operator Aritmatika dalam Matlab
Pengeksekusian sebuah operasi matematika, Matlab mengikut aturan-aturan sebagai berikut:
Matlab memprioritaskan operasi yang berada di dalam kurung
Operasi yang melibatkan operator * dan / (dapat * / atau / *) bekerja dari kiri ke kanan.
Operasi matematika yang melibatkan operator + dan (dapat + - atau - +) juga bekerja dari kiri ke
kanan.
Contoh Perhatikan Contoh penerapan matlab untuk perhitungan sederhana berikut ini:
-
Page 6
Latihan Cari di help matlab untuk menyeleseikan soal kalkulus 1 dan 2 yang berkaitan dengan
differensial/turunan dan integral.
-
Page 7
Praktikum 2. Konsep vektor & matriks di bid.teknik Array dan Matrik Semua data dan operasinya di MATLAB diperlakukan sebagai array (Ingat Mata Kuliah Dasar-
dasar Pemrograman). Array adalah tempat yang mampu menyimpan beberapa nilai dengan
tipe yang sama.
MATLAB adalah singkatan dari matrix laboratory. Oleh karena itu pemahaman terhadap
konsep matrik harus memadai agar dapat memanfaatkan MATLAB dengan maksimal.
Penulisan dan Pengaksesan Matrik di MATLAB Elemen matrik ditulis dalam tanda kurung siku. Tanda koma (,) atau spasi digunakan
untuk memisahkan elemen-elemen satu baris. Tanda titik koma(;) digunakan untuk
memisahkan elemen-elemen satu kolom.
Pengaksesan matrik yaitu dengan format: nama_variabel(baris_ke, kolom_ke)
Pendefiinisian matrik dengan cara lain :[First:Incr:Last]
Contoh:
-
Page 8
Visualisasi
Vektor merupakan matrik yang hanya terdiri atas satu kolom atau satu baris saja.
Cara pendefinisiannya sebagai berikut:
Menentukan Ukuran Vektor
Operasi pada Matrik
Determinan Matrik Invers Matrik Matrik Transpose
Vektor Baris
Vektor Kolom
Ukuran Vektor Baris
Ukuran Vektor Kolom
-
Page 9
Latihan 1. Definisikan macam-macam matrik yang sudah disampaikan dalam matlab
2. Browsing diinternet tentang M-File dalam matlab kemudian definisikan macam-
macam matrik yang sudah diterangkan dalam memori komputer.(menggunakan M-
File bukan command window).
top related